Statutory Rules 1985 No. 2411
Currency Regulations2 (Amendment)
I, THE ADMINISTRATOR of the Government of the Commonwealth of Australia, acting with the advice of the Federal Executive Council, hereby make the following Regulations under the Currency Act 1965.
Dated 19 September 1985.
J. A. ROWLAND Administrator By His Excellency's Command,
C. J. Hurford Minister of State for Immigration and Ethnic Affairs for and on behalf of the Treasurer
Commencement 1. These Regulations shall come into operation on 1 October 1985.
Design of coins 2. Regulation 4 of the Currency Regulations is amended by inserting after sub-paragraph (d) (viiic) the following sub-paragraph: "(viiid) in the case of a coin of the denomination of $10 that refers on its obverse side to the year 1985 as the year of the coin—the inscriptions "1835•VICTORIA•1985" and "10 DOLLARS" and a representation of the coat of arms of the State of Victoria;".
NOTES
1. Notified in the Commonwealth of Australia Gazette on 27 September 1985. 2. Statutory Rules 1966 No. 21 as amended by 1969 No. 137; 1970 No. 31; 1975 No. 139; 1977 No. 17; 1980 No. 288; 1981 Nos. 199 and 344; 1984 No. 29.
